Point72 Asset Management L.P. Sells 218,000 Shares of Thomson Reuters Co. (NYSE:TRI)

Thomson Reuters logo with Business Services background

Point72 Asset Management L.P. reduced its position in shares of Thomson Reuters Co. (NYSE:TRI - Free Report) TSE: TRI by 45.4% during the second quarter, according to the company in its most recent 13F filing with the SEC. The firm owned 262,500 shares of the business services provider's stock after selling 218,000 shares during the quarter. Point72 Asset Management L.P. owned about 0.06% of Thomson Reuters worth $44,250,000 at the end of the most recent quarter.

Thomson Reuters Company Profile

(Free Report)

Thomson Reuters Corporation engages in the provision of business information services in the Americas, Europe, the Middle East, Africa, and the Asia Pacific. It operates in five segments: Legal Professionals, Corporates, Tax & Accounting Professionals, Reuters News, and Global Print. The Legal Professionals segment offers research and workflow products focusing on legal research and integrated legal workflow solutions that combine content, tools, and analytics to law firms and governments.
